 Standard Features:
Key Features
  New dual injector Digital Fuel Injection system  
  More robust high-rpm engine output extends deep into the overrev  
  Revised transmission offers improved shifting action and durability  
  Thicker, stronger engine components improve reliability  
  Revised Showa Separate Function Fork (SFF) offers more supple initial hit, and improved action during corner entry  
  Increased spring rates on front and rear suspension enhance traction and offer a more solid feel  
High Revving, High Performance Engine
  249 cc, li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, 4-valve, 1-cylinder DOHC engine delivers hard-hitting power across the rpm range  
  Improved decompressor spring action for easier starting  
  New nickel plating on cylinder walls has a higher adhesion factor for increased durability  
  New connecting rod has a thicker stem for improved reliability  
  New more rigid crankshaft is re-balanced for better performance and higher durability  
  Thicker crank web design features a balance factor on par with the factory racers for reduced engine vibration, smoother power delivery and increased performance in the mid-high rpm range  
  Revised ACG stator and rotor inertia complements the changes made to the crankshaft  
Digital Fuel Injection (DFI) System
  Upgraded system adds a new “upstream” injector located closer to the airbox  
  All-new second injector features different body size, but same capacity as primary injector  
  Added seal between air inlet port and throttle position sensor unit on the 43 mm throttle body protects TPS sensor from fuel penetration  
  Progressive throttle linkage opens more quickly after 3/8 open position  
  Simple and efficient system: No battery, fuses or relays  
  Sharp and precise engine response across entire rpm range  
  Offers easy engine starting  
  Helps prevent engine hesitation after landing from jumps and other high-impact situations  
Bridged Box-bottom Piston
  Light and strong piston shares same design as the factory racers, with a new tin plating to optimize its interface with the new nickel plating on the cylinder wall  
  Changed shape of streak finish improves lubrication and wear resistance  
  Short piston pin reduces reciprocating weight  
Lightweight and Efficient Top End
  Lightweight, highly rigid, titanium 31 mm intake and 25 mm exhaust valves reduce reciprocating weight and offer high-rpm reliability  
  Ultra-light valves have extremely thin valve stems on par with those found in supersport machines; intake valves feature thick heads for increased strength  
  Intake ports designed for peak performance at all rpm, especially in the high-rpm range  
  Special casting method leaves the intake port surfaces extremely smooth for optimum intake efficiency across the rev range  
  Silicon-coated head gasket provides excellent sealing  
Stainless Steel Exhaust System
  Stainless steel construction offers extra durability  
  High-volume muffler assembly keeps noise levels at 94 dB while retaining power production  
  Joint between pipe and muffler offers excellent sealing, while a rubber damper collar on the rear silencer mount equals serious durability  
Efficient Cooling System
  Thick and wide radiators are strong and offer excellent resistance to mud buildup while providing superb cooling performance  
  Cylinder head water jacket routes coolant to the front of the cylinder head for even cooling  
Transmission and Shifting
  Shorter shift fork stroke and more smooth solid shift forks (not hollow) offer improved shifting action  
  Strong, beefy crankcases feature additional material around the engine mounts to help increase long-term durability  
  Clutch cable holder is integrated with the crankcase for accurate feel at the clutch lever  
  Scavenge oil filter screen can be accessed without splitting the crankcases, facilitating easier maintenance  
Quick-turning Chassis
  Utilizes a low-rigidity steering stem for lighter handling  
  The KX250F’s slim and lightweight aluminum perimeter frame is composed of forged, extruded and cast parts  
  Center of gravity and key dimensions such as swingarm pivot, output sprocket and rear axle locations designed to increase forward drive with minimal rear-end squat  
  Upper engine mounts on head cover sides increase overall rigidity  
Race-oriented Suspension
  Revised race-oriented suspension features heavier spring rates and revised damping settings both front and rear  
  Separate Function Fork (SFF) separates springing and damping functions for less weight, better performance, less stiction and easier adjustability  
  Fork features the only external spring preload adjustability in its class  
  Super-hard titanium coating on the outer surface of the inner fork tubes reduces stiction and improves suspension action while also helping prevent scratches and tube damage  
  Friction-reducing Kashima Coat treatment on the inside of the outer fork tubes contributes to smoother suspension action  
  Wrap-around fork tube guards provide greater protection for the inner tubes  
  Altered piston rod specs improve shock setting flexibility and offer better rear wheel traction  
  Features Kashima Coat on the inside of the shock reservoir for reduced friction and smoother suspension action  
  Rear shock features dual compression adjustability, allowing high-speed and low-speed damping to be tuned separately  
Superior Rear-wheel Traction
  Swingarm features optimum internal bracing and flex characteristics for superb cornering performance  
  Alloy swingarm uses a cast front section, tapered hydro-formed spars and forged chain adjusters  
  Uni-Trak® rear suspension linkage system mounts the suspension arm below the swingarm, allowing more rear suspension stroke and precise tuning  
  Linkage system receives upgraded tie-rod which has less rigidity for smoother suspension action and improved traction  
  Linkage ratios for the Uni-Trak rear suspension match rear shock damping settings to achieve maximum rear wheel traction  
Rider Interface
  Bodywork components offer the rider a slim interface, making it easy for racers to feel comfortable and go fast  
  Formed using a double-injection molding process, the 2-tone shrouds offer a slim design  
  Side number plates also 2-toned and contribute to the slim package  
  Right side panel has an added passageway to help cool the silencer  
  Frame is wider at the ankles to offer better grip and narrows near the bend below the seat to allow a slim riding position  
  Slim seat features upgraded polyurethane, designed for greater durability  
  Seat has a slip-resistant top and side surface for good grip when seated and while standing  
  50 mm wide (front-to-rear) footpegs offer superb grip and feel at the pegs  
  Clutch cable boot features a large quick adjuster, making it easy for riders to adjust play in the clutch cable while on the fly  
  Throttle grip has a 1-piece collar that provides additional stability during throttle operation  
  Lightweight short-length grips feature a pattern designed to provide excellent grip  
Factory-style Components
  Black alumite-coated rims, just like the factory racers  
  Titanium coated inner fork tubes to minimize stiction  
  Lightweight rims offer maximum strength and weight savings  
  Thick and rigid front fender  
  Rear brake pad material offers powerful braking performance  
  Front and rear petal brake discs help reduce unsprung weight, and the wave shape helps clean the brake pads for more efficient stopping performance  
  Rear caliper guard protects caliper from damage  
  Ribless rear hub and butted spokes further reduce unsprung weight  
  Renthal aluminum handlebar is standard equipment  
  Blue ignition cover plugs and oil filler cap match the blue accents on the factory race bikes  
  Factory-style graphics complement the KX250F’s highly tuned performance  
Additional Features
  New countershaft sprocket cover improves look  
  New polyurethane resin drive chain roller reduces weight  
  Redesigned air boot allows room for second fuel injector  
  Large resin skid plate offers great protection with minimum weight
